Understanding Paint Types and Removal Methods

Types of Automotive Paint

Automotive paints come in various formulations, each requiring specific removal techniques.

  • Acrylic Enamel: The most common type, known for its durability and ease of application.
  • Lacquer: A fast-drying paint that offers a high-gloss finish but is more susceptible to chipping and scratching.
  • Urethane: A highly durable and resistant paint often used in high-performance vehicles.

Identifying your car’s paint type is crucial for selecting the appropriate removal method.

Removal Methods

Several methods exist for paint removal, each with its pros and cons.

  • Chemical Strippers: These powerful solvents dissolve paint, making it easy to peel away. However, they can be harsh on the underlying surface and require careful handling.
  • Sanding: A more manual approach, sanding gradually removes paint layers. It’s effective for smaller areas but can be time-consuming for larger jobs.
  • Media Blasting: This technique uses abrasive materials like sand or plastic pellets propelled at high speed to strip paint. It’s efficient for large areas but requires specialized equipment.
  • Heat Gun: Applying heat softens the paint, allowing it to be scraped or peeled off. It’s a relatively quick method but can damage the underlying surface if not used carefully.

Chemical Paint Strippers: A Detailed Guide

Choosing the Right Stripper

Chemical strippers come in various formulations, each designed for specific paint types and surfaces.

  • Water-Based Strippers: Environmentally friendly and less toxic, but may be less effective on tough paints.
  • Solvent-Based Strippers: Powerful and fast-acting, but require proper ventilation and safety precautions.

Always read the product label carefully and choose a stripper compatible with your car’s paint type and the area you’re treating.

Application and Safety Precautions

Applying a chemical stripper requires careful attention to safety and proper technique. (See Also: How Much Does Paint Car Cost? – A Detailed Breakdown)

  • Wear Protective Gear: Always wear gloves, safety glasses, and a respirator mask to protect yourself from fumes and skin contact.
  • Work in a Well-Ventilated Area: Ensure adequate ventilation to prevent the buildup of harmful fumes.
  • Apply Thin Coats: Apply the stripper in thin, even coats, following the manufacturer’s instructions.
  • Allow Sufficient Dwell Time: Let the stripper sit for the recommended time to effectively dissolve the paint.
  • Remove Paint with a Scraper: Use a plastic scraper to gently remove the softened paint.
  • Neutralize the Stripper: Follow the manufacturer’s instructions for neutralizing the stripper and cleaning the surface.

Sanding Techniques for Paint Removal

Choosing the Right Sandpaper

Sandpaper comes in various grits, ranging from coarse to fine. The grit you choose depends on the amount of paint to be removed and the desired finish.

  • Coarse Grit (80-120): Effective for removing thick layers of paint but can leave deep scratches.
  • Medium Grit (150-220): Suitable for removing most paint layers and smoothing out coarse scratches.
  • Fine Grit (320-600): Used for final sanding to achieve a smooth surface for repainting.

Sanding Techniques

Sanding requires a systematic approach to ensure an even finish and avoid damaging the underlying surface.

  • Start with Coarse Grit: Begin with a coarse grit sandpaper to remove the bulk of the paint.
  • Gradually Progress to Finer Grits: Move to progressively finer grits to smooth out scratches and create a uniform surface.
  • Sand with the Grain: Always sand in the direction of the vehicle’s body lines to avoid creating swirl marks.
  • Apply Light Pressure: Avoid pressing too hard, as this can gouge the surface.
  • Regularly Clean the Surface: Remove sanding dust frequently to prevent clogging the sandpaper and ensure an even finish.

Media Blasting: A Powerful Paint Removal Solution

How Media Blasting Works

Media blasting uses a high-pressure stream of abrasive materials to strip paint from surfaces.

The abrasive media, typically sand, plastic pellets, or glass beads, is propelled at high speed by compressed air or water. The force of the impact dislodges the paint, leaving a clean surface.

Advantages of Media Blasting

  • Efficiency: Media blasting is highly efficient for removing large areas of paint quickly.
  • Precision: With proper technique and equipment, media blasting can be precise, allowing for selective paint removal.
  • Minimal Surface Damage: When performed correctly, media blasting can minimize damage to the underlying surface.

Considerations for Media Blasting

While effective, media blasting requires specialized equipment and expertise.

  • Safety Precautions: Media blasting generates a lot of dust and debris, so proper safety gear and ventilation are essential.
  • Surface Preparation: The surface must be properly prepared before blasting to prevent damage to underlying components.
  • Environmental Impact: Media blasting can create dust and debris, so it’s important to minimize environmental impact by using appropriate containment measures.

Heat Gun Paint Removal: A Quick but Careful Approach

How Heat Guns Work

Heat guns apply concentrated heat to soften paint, making it easier to scrape or peel off. (See Also: Can You Wrap a Car with Paint Damage? – A Safe Solution)

The heat causes the paint to expand and become more pliable, allowing it to be removed without excessive sanding or chemical stripping.

Advantages of Heat Gun Removal

  • Speed: Heat guns can quickly soften paint, making the removal process faster than sanding or chemical stripping.
  • Minimal Surface Damage: When used carefully, heat guns can minimize damage to the underlying surface.

Cautions and Safety Tips

Heat guns require careful handling to avoid damaging the surface.

  • Low Heat Setting: Start with a low heat setting and gradually increase the temperature as needed.
  • Avoid Overheating: Don’t overheat the surface, as this can warp or damage the paint and underlying material.
  • Constant Movement: Keep the heat gun in constant motion to prevent localized overheating.
  • Protective Gear: Wear safety glasses and gloves to protect yourself from heat and debris.

How do I prepare my car for paint removal?

Before removing paint, thoroughly clean the car to remove dirt, grime, and loose debris. Mask off any areas you don’t want to be stripped, such as windows, trim, and lights. Protect yourself and your surroundings with appropriate safety gear, such as gloves, safety glasses, and a respirator mask. (See Also: How Many Pints Of Paint To Paint A Car? – The Ultimate Guide)

Can I use a heat gun to remove all types of paint?

While heat guns can effectively remove some types of paint, they may not be suitable for all formulations. Always test the heat gun on a small, inconspicuous area first to ensure it doesn’t damage the paint or underlying surface.

What should I do after removing paint from my car?

After removing paint, thoroughly clean the surface to remove any residue from the stripper, sanding dust, or media blasting. Inspect the surface for any damage and make necessary repairs before priming and painting.

Is it safe to dispose of paint stripper and sanding dust?

Paint strippers and sanding dust can be hazardous to the environment and human health. Dispose of them properly according to local regulations. Contact your local waste management facility for guidance on safe disposal methods.
